What Makes a Great Locksmith Website Design Company
Before diving into the agency list, it’s worth understanding what separates exceptional locksmith web design from generic business websites. The best agencies share several critical characteristics that drive real results for locksmith businesses.
First, they prioritize emergency conversion architecture. When someone visits a locksmith website, they’re typically in an urgent situation. The best design companies build sites with huge, unmissable call buttons—often in contrasting colors—placed above the fold. Every page should scream availability and immediate response.
Second, local SEO optimization is non-negotiable. Locksmiths serve specific geographic areas, and search engines need to understand that. Top agencies implement proper schema markup, Google Business Profile integration, location-specific content, and mobile-responsive design that loads in under three seconds.

Third, trust-building elements matter immensely. Locksmith businesses face a unique challenge: rogue operators and scam companies have damaged the industry’s reputation. Legitimate locksmiths need websites that establish credibility immediately through licenses, certifications, real customer reviews, and professional photography.
The best web design companies understand that WordPress powers over 40% of the internet—it offers unmatched SEO control and scalability. But the platform matters less than how it’s configured. Speed, mobile responsiveness, and conversion optimization trump fancy features every time.

Platform Considerations for Locksmith Websites
While the agency matters tremendously, the underlying platform affects long-term success. WordPress dominates locksmith web design for several compelling reasons that agencies consistently emphasize.
For starters, WordPress offers unmatched SEO control. Locksmiths compete in crowded local markets where ranking factors like site speed, mobile responsiveness, structured data, and content optimization determine visibility. WordPress plugins and themes provide granular control over these elements.
Scalability matters too. A locksmith business might start serving one neighborhood but expand to multiple cities over time. WordPress makes it straightforward to add location pages, service categories, and content without rebuilding the entire site. That flexibility prevents expensive redesigns as businesses grow.
The platform’s ecosystem includes countless plugins for features locksmith websites need—appointment booking, review integration, emergency contact forms, and local business schema markup. Agencies can implement these features efficiently without custom coding.
But here’s the reality: platform choice matters less than implementation quality. A poorly configured WordPress site performs worse than a well-built site on almost any other platform. Speed optimization, proper heading structure, mobile responsiveness, and conversion-focused layout trump the underlying technology.
Essential Features Every Locksmith Website Needs
Regardless of which agency builds the site, certain features are non-negotiable for locksmith websites. These elements appear consistently across successful locksmith sites and directly impact conversion rates.
Mobile-First Responsive Design
Mobile devices account for a significant portion of locksmith searches, often from someone standing outside their locked car or home. Websites must load quickly and display perfectly on smartphones.
The best locksmith websites feature huge tap targets for phone numbers, simplified navigation on small screens, and critical information visible without scrolling or zooming. Testing on actual devices—not just desktop browser resizing—ensures genuine mobile usability.
Prominent Call-to-Action Elements
Emergency services require emergency-ready design. That means call buttons should be impossible to miss—contrasting colors, large sizes, and placement at the top of every page.
Some top locksmith sites include sticky headers with call buttons that remain visible while scrolling. Others use click-to-call functionality that initiates phone calls with a single tap on mobile devices. The goal is eliminating any friction between “I need help” and “I’m calling this locksmith.”

Service Area Targeting
Locksmiths serve specific geographic regions, and websites should reflect that clearly. Dedicated location pages help with local SEO while setting proper customer expectations about service coverage.
The best implementations create individual pages for each major service area—”Locksmith Services in [Neighborhood Name]”—with unique content about local landmarks, service specifics, and customer testimonials from that area. This approach helps sites rank for location-specific searches.
Trust and Credibility Elements
The locksmith industry faces unique trust challenges. Websites must overcome visitor skepticism through transparent credibility signals.
That includes displaying license numbers prominently, professional association memberships (like ALOA), insurance information, and genuine customer reviews. Real photos of technicians and vehicles build more trust than stock imagery. Many top locksmith sites include «Our Team» pages with photos and backgrounds of actual locksmiths.
Speed Optimization
Website speed isn’t just a nice feature—it directly impacts conversion rates and search rankings. Community discussions consistently highlight that companies have doubled lead volume simply by rebuilding slow, cluttered websites.
Emergency service websites need to load in under three seconds, preferably under two. That requires image optimization, code minification, quality hosting, and elimination of unnecessary scripts. Every second of delay reduces conversion rates significantly.
Red Flags When Choosing a Web Design Agency
Not every agency claiming locksmith expertise delivers quality results. Several warning signs indicate agencies that should be avoided.
First, beware of agencies using generic templates without customization. If the demo site looks identical across multiple industries with only logos swapped, conversion rates will suffer. Locksmith websites require industry-specific design patterns.
Second, avoid agencies that ignore mobile optimization. Any agency that shows desktop mockups without discussing mobile performance doesn’t understand modern web design. Test their portfolio sites on actual mobile devices—if they load slowly or look broken, walk away.
Third, watch for agencies that separate web design from SEO. These disciplines shouldn’t be siloed. Local SEO requirements should inform design decisions from the beginning—site structure, content hierarchy, technical implementation, and conversion optimization all interconnect.
Finally, steer clear of agencies making unrealistic promises about rankings or leads. SEO takes time, and conversion optimization requires testing. Legitimate agencies discuss processes and timelines honestly rather than guaranteeing specific results.

DIY vs. Professional Agency: Making the Right Choice
Some locksmith businesses consider building their own websites using template builders or WordPress themes. This approach can work for businesses with technical skills and time to invest, but several factors should inform this decision.
Template-based website builders offer quick deployment and low initial costs. However, they often lack the customization needed for optimal locksmith conversion. Generic templates don’t understand emergency service psychology or local SEO best practices.
WordPress with a quality theme provides more flexibility but requires technical knowledge to configure properly. Speed optimization, mobile responsiveness, SEO implementation, and security all demand expertise that most locksmith business owners don’t have.
Professional agencies bring specialized knowledge, design skills, and technical implementation that’s difficult to replicate as a DIY project. The question isn’t whether agencies cost more—it’s whether the investment generates positive ROI through increased leads and bookings.
For established locksmith businesses serious about growth, professional agency design typically pays for itself quickly through improved conversion rates and better search rankings. For new businesses with extremely limited budgets, a template might serve as a temporary solution until professional redesign becomes affordable.
